Mobile Laboratory Assistants

play an important part in on-site patient care in locations including private homes, commercial facilities, and long-term care facilities. This is an active and rewarding role that will let you build relationships with patients and see the difference that you make in their lives and healthcare outcomes.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Organizing a daily schedule of visits to facilities and private residences to collect specimens as per physicians’ requests, and planning your route according to courier times, specimen integrity and required travel time.
  • Performing phlebotomies, connecting/disconnecting Holter monitors, and performing ECG tracings.
  • Collecting and delivering specimens to designated labs for testing. Accession, spin, separate and prepare for transport to reference lab as required.
  • Booking patient appointments, requesting required information from patients, explaining the specimen collection process and ensuring patients have followed necessary test protocol prior to specimen collection.
  • Liaising with doctors and facility staff regarding patient problems, changes in scheduling, specimen collection procedures, and other matters.

What you will bring to the role:

  • Graduate of an approved Laboratory Assistant program or equivalent.
  •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record and access to a vehicle.
  • Satisfactory criminal reference check.
  • Excellent communication skills to enable you to relate with a wide variety of people.
  • Problem solving skills and the ability to think quickly on your feet.
  • Ability to maintain the strictest standards of patient privacy and confidentiality.
